Output ddc58b8063fbb63b51c9065fdb52cba9bc2d5cf6643c269ab47e41e1deb79b9e:1

value
578581
script pubkey
OP_0 OP_PUSHBYTES_20 bb1716dda30a1c8c928744dd82c6796c9bec599c
address
bc1qhvt3dhdrpgwgey58gnwc93nedjd7ckvuc5ex0v
transaction
ddc58b8063fbb63b51c9065fdb52cba9bc2d5cf6643c269ab47e41e1deb79b9e
confirmations
173530
spent
true